Galaxy Digital Slips 7% on $1.15B Exchangeable Debt Raise
Yahoo Finance· 2025-10-28 14:00
Mike Novogratz's Galaxy Digital (GLXY) is selling $1.15 billion in exchangeable notes in a private deal, upsizing from last night's originally offered $1 billion. Estimated net proceeds of $1.127 billion (or $1.274 billion if the full $150 million greenshoe option is exercised), said the company.
